Yuan appreciation - what it means for China-UK trade

British Prime Minister Theresa May made an official visit to China last week, and the timing of the visit could not have come at a more opportune time, says Andy Seaman, partner and chief investment officer of Stratton Street. 

Seaman told Citywire Asia that the UK economy is going to need to develop strong trade relationships with numerous countries post Brexit, and China arguably is the most important of all.

During May’s visit, Chinese President Xi Jinping agreed to hold a new trade and investment review with the UK. This is perceived as a stepping stone towards delivering a full free trade agreement after Brexit.
